What you need to know
The Bank of Canada is at the forefront of cyber security, investing in the latest technologies to deliver best-in-class security within a world-class institution The Cyber Monitoring and Response Portfolio, part of the Cyber Security Division, adopt a proactive and intelligent driven approach to predicting, preventing, detecting and responding to cyber threats, protecting both a vital piece of Canada’s critical national infrastructure and the Bank’s digital assets.
What you will do
In this role, you will help protect the Bank's information assets and technology services by monitoring, detecting, investigating, and responding to cyber threats that could impact their confidentiality, integrity, and availability. As a senior member of the Cyber Monitoring & Response (M&R) team, you will provide technical leadership within the Security Operations Centre (SOC), driving the continuous evolution of threat detection, security monitoring, incident response, automation, and operational processes.
As a subject matter expert in security operations, you will mentor and support analysts, collaborate with Cyber Security, Information Technology, and business partners, and contribute to strategic cybersecurity initiatives. Through your leadership, you will enhance visibility into emerging threats, improve operational efficiency, advance the maturity of the Bank's cyber defence capabilities, and help ensure the SOC remains effective and resilient in an increasingly complex threat landscape. Your work will play a critical role in protecting the Bank's operations and supporting its long-term mission.

What you need to know
Hybrid Work Model
The Bank offers work arrangements that provide employees with flexibility, enable high-performing teams, and support an excellent workplace culture. Most employees can telework from home for a portion of each month as part of the Bank’s hybrid work model, and they are expected on site at the Bank location a minimum of 12 days per month to help build connections between colleagues. You must live in Canada, and within reasonable commuting distance of the office.
